WebIn the Austrian countryside, young composer Lewis Dodd visits the reclusive composer Albert Sanger and his daughters. One of the daughters, Tessa, falls in love with Lewis, but he breaks her heart by marrying his English cousin, Florence Churchill, and moving to London. Tessa moves to London as well, and when Lewis reads in her diary that she … WebTessa Sanger has been in love with her father's musical successor for most of her life (although she is only fourteen at the start of the novel). Tessa and Lewis share a special bond that only Tessa realizes. Florence Churchill, Tessa's cousin, comes to take the children to England and simultaneously falls in love with the quiet musical composer.
